The Harrisburg JCC summer camp, run by the Jewish Federation of Greater Harrisburg at the Alexander Grass Campus (2986 N. 2nd St.), is an eight-week full-day day camp running roughly mid-June through early August, Monday-Friday 8:30am-4:15pm with before/after care. Weeks are themed and campers can choose elective tracks in STEM (4th grade and up), sports, and fine arts.
